North London leads Europe

Wayne Rooney scored with a spectacular overhead kick to delight the home crowd as United beat City 2-1 in the Manchester derby while a double from Dutchman van Persie saw off Wolves at Arsenal, and Tottenham came from behind to win 2-1 at Sunderland. Liverpool could only manage a 1-1 draw at home to Wigan, and a last gasp Zigic goal was the difference between Birmingham and stoke while Aston Villa drew 1-1 at Blackpool. There were no goals between Blackburn and Newcastle but 6 goals at West Brom as West Ham came from 3 down to earn a point with 2 goals from Demba Ba. Everton lost 2-0 at Bolton and on Monday evening Chelsea drew 0-0 at Fulham who had a Clint Dempsey penalty saved in stoppage time.
Both Arsenal and Tottenham faced formidable opposition in the first leg of Champions league knockout stage and came out with flying colours. Tottenham returned from the San Siro with a 1-0 victory over AC Milan and on Wednesday Arsenal came from behind to overcome the mighty Barcelona 2-1 at the Emirates. In the Europa League Manchester City and Liverpool played out goalless matches at Aris Thessaloniki and Sparta Prague respectively
